Second Annual Dialogue in Action Series
First Lutheran Church 1100 E Superior St, Duluth, MNThe First Lutheran Church of Duluth Foundation invites the community to its second annual Dialogue in Action Series, which is free to attend. Scheduled for May 6, 2025, at the First Lutheran Church Sanctuary, located at 1100 E. Superior Street in Duluth, Minnesota, this event aims to foster dialogue and enhance understanding of critical social justice issues, building on the success of last year's inaugural series. This year's event features Dr. Jemar Tisby, a distinguished public historian, advocate for racial justice, and founder of The Witness, Inc. Dr. Tisby is a history professor at Simmons College of Kentucky. His insightful presentations, drawn from his acclaimed works, including 'The Color of Compromise' and 'How to Fight Racism,' inspire deep reflection and proactive steps toward societal change. From Spiritual to Spirituals: Music of Praise and Hope
First Lutheran Church 1100 E Superior St, Duluth, MNFeaturing guest soprano Hope Koehler (West Virginia University, American Spiritual Ensemble), the Arrowhead Chorale explores sacred music in a variety of expressions from early chant to Mozart’s majestic Coronation Mass K. 319 to Sanctus from Leonard Bernstein’s Mass. The focus will then shift to the American spiritual, a truly unique and powerful genre described as “breathing the prayer and complaint of souls boiling over with the bitterest anguish.”

Holiday Traditions & Jubilations: GLORIA!
First Lutheran Church 1100 E Superior St, Duluth, MNAudiences will experience new and traditional settings of Gloria, with carol settings old and new featuring works of Mozart, Wilberg, and – the centerpiece of the concert – John Rutter’s breathtaking Gloria. The Chorale will collaborate with organ, brass, orchestra, and the highly esteemed Strikepoint Handbell Ensemble to fill First Lutheran Church of Duluth with the glorious sounds of Christmas.
